我已经在我的C:\
驱动器上安装了Docker Desktop一段时间了,它一直占用我的SSD空间。即使我删除了我所有的容器和图像,它仍然需要大量的空间,我猜是一些缓存文件或其他东西。我恢复SSD空间的唯一方法是完全卸载Docker Desktop。
我一直在尝试将Docker Desktop安装到更大的硬盘上,但安装程序上没有这个选项。我已经看到some guides关于修改服务和提供--data-root
标志,但它似乎不起作用。我无法重新启动dockerd
服务等。
我已经在我的C:\
驱动器上安装了Docker Desktop一段时间了,它一直占用我的SSD空间。即使我删除了我所有的容器和图像,它仍然需要大量的空间,我猜是一些缓存文件或其他东西。我恢复SSD空间的唯一方法是完全卸载Docker Desktop。
我一直在尝试将Docker Desktop安装到更大的硬盘上,但安装程序上没有这个选项。我已经看到some guides关于修改服务和提供--data-root
标志,但它似乎不起作用。我无法重新启动dockerd
服务等。
1条答案
按热度按时间kcugc4gi1#
我最近也在尝试做同样的事情;在不同驱动器上重新安装Docker。事实上,我试图保持我所有安装的应用程序在一个单独的驱动器比Windows操作系统安装。
要在E:\Docker\Docker驱动器上安装Docker,我做了以下操作:
start /w "" "Docker Desktop Installer.exe" install -accept-license --installation-dir=E:\Docker\Docker
一件事,它将安装docker到单独的驱动器。但WSL、镜像等仍将位于%HOME%\AppData\Local\Docker中
文件:https://docs.docker.com/desktop/install/windows-install/#install-from-the-command-line